Oak Tree Lodge
114 Lyndhurst Road, Ashurst, Southampton, Hampshire, SO40 7AUPatient ratings and reviews
No reviews
Help others by sharing your thoughts and experiences about Oak Tree Lodge.
Help others by sharing your thoughts and experiences about Oak Tree Lodge.